CBCC Comments on Waterfront Station Parcel Bids

Applying its principles for redevelopment (see The Southwester, November 2015), the Near SE/SW Community Benefits Coordinating Council (CBCC) submitted comments on Oct. 9 to the Office of the Deputy Mayor for Planning and Economic Development (DMPED) on the three finalists bidding for the 1000 4th Street Waterfront Station Parcel. Computers-for-Kids Winter Graduation

More than 30 guests attended the SWNA Youth Activities Task Force (YATF) Computers-for-Kids graduation on Saturday, Dec. 12. Held in partnership with the James Creek Resident Council located on N St. SW, the winter graduation was déjà vu, as this was the site of the first and most successful computer training class held in Oct.
